Understanding EMV Software
EMV Software is a payment technology framework designed to enhance security and prevent fraud in electronic transactions. Unlike traditional magnetic stripe card transactions, which are susceptible to skimming and cloning, EMV transactions utilize chip-based authentication, making them more secure. The EMV standard has been widely adopted across the globe, ensuring compliance with stringent security requirements set by financial institutions and payment processors.
EMV software operates in different layers, with each level serving a distinct function. EMV Level 1 (L1) focuses on the physical and electrical characteristics of the card-terminal communication, ensuring proper data exchange between the chip card and the POS terminal. EMV Level 2 (L2) (EMV Kernel) handles transaction processing logic, including application selection, cardholder authentication, and cryptographic verification. EMV Level 3 (L3) ensures end-to-end compliance by testing and certifying payment transactions with acquiring banks and payment processors, ensuring that the entire payment process meets security and functional standards.
One of the core features of EMV software is its ability to perform cryptographic authentication, which validates cardholder details and secures transactions against fraudulent activities. The software also incorporates risk management mechanisms such as offline PIN verification, transaction limits, and dynamic authentication codes, further reducing the chances of unauthorized transactions. Additionally, tokenization and encryption techniques are employed to replace sensitive card details with unique digital tokens, ensuring that customer data remains protected throughout the transaction lifecycle.
EMV software supports multi-currency transactions, making it an essential tool for businesses operating in international markets. By integrating with banking systems and payment gateways, EMV software facilitates seamless cross-border payments while adhering to local and global security regulations. As the payment industry continues to evolve, EMV technology has become a crucial component in mitigating fraud risks and ensuring compliance with stringent security standards.
Benefits of EMV Software
The adoption of EMV software has significantly reduced card fraud, particularly in card-present transactions. EMV chip cards prevent cloning and skimming attacks, providing an added layer of security for both merchants and consumers.
Regulatory compliance is another major advantage, as EMV technology meets PCI DSS and EMVCo certification requirements, ensuring adherence to international security standards.
EMV software also enhances security for both online and offline transactions. With advanced encryption and authentication mechanisms, cardholder data is protected from potential breaches and unauthorized access.
This heightened level of security fosters consumer trust, as customers feel more confident using EMV-compliant payment methods.
As a result, businesses that implement EMV software can benefit from reduced chargebacks, improved financial security, and a positive reputation in the payment industry.
Understanding POS Terminals
A Point-of-Sale (POS) terminal is a physical device that allows merchants to process electronic payments via credit and debit cards. Over time, these terminals have evolved from simple magnetic stripe card readers to sophisticated machines that support chip-based transactions, contactless payments, mobile wallet integrations, and even advanced business management features. POS terminals play an indispensable role in various industries, including retail, hospitality, and service sectors, as they streamline the checkout process while ensuring security and compliance with payment regulations.
Traditional POS terminals are commonly found at fixed retail checkout counters, offering a stable and reliable way to handle large volumes of transactions. Mobile POS (mPOS) terminals, on the other hand, provide flexibility for small businesses, food trucks, and on-the-go vendors, as they connect via Bluetooth or Wi-Fi and enable transactions anywhere. Smart POS terminals, which integrate touchscreens, inventory management, and customer engagement features, have become increasingly popular due to their versatility and enhanced user experience.
One of the core functionalities of POS terminals is their ability to process various types of payment methods. These include traditional magnetic stripe swipes, chip-based transactions, NFC-enabled contactless payments, and mobile wallets such as Apple Pay and Google Pay. Connectivity options also play a crucial role in the efficiency of POS terminals. Modern devices support Ethernet, Wi-Fi, and cellular networks, ensuring uninterrupted transactions even in remote locations.
Security remains a significant focus in POS terminals, as these devices handle sensitive payment data. Features such as encryption, tokenization, and PCI-DSS (Payment Card Industry Data Security Standard) compliance help safeguard against fraudulent activities and data breaches. Additionally, POS terminals can integrate with various business software solutions, including accounting software, inventory management systems, and customer relationship management (CRM) platforms. Some terminals also come equipped with built-in printers, enabling physical receipt generation, while others support digital receipts via email or SMS.

Future of POS Terminals and EMV Software
The future of payment solutions is poised for significant advancements, with emerging technologies shaping the industry. AI and machine learning are increasingly being integrated into POS and EMV systems to provide predictive analytics for fraud detection and customer behavior analysis. Blockchain technology is also gaining traction as a means to enhance transaction security through decentralized verification methods.
Contactless payments and QR code transactions continue to grow in popularity, offering consumers a fast and secure way to complete purchases without physical card interactions. Additionally, the rise of SoftPOS adoption is revolutionizing the industry by enabling merchants to accept payments directly through smartphones and tablets without dedicated hardware.
